Robocopy: accès refusé lors de la copie - Logiciels - Windows & Software
Marsh Posté le 15-02-2009 à 10:44:14
En général c'est quand un fichier est ouvert avec un accès exclusif.
Ajoute /ZB dans ta ligne de commande. Note : ce paramètre nécessite que ton batch tourne avec des privilèges élevés, par exemple admin ou opérateur de sauvegarde.
/ZB :: utilise le mode de redémarrage ; si l'accès est refusé, utilise le mode de sauvegarde. |
Je te conseille aussi d'ajouter /W:1 et /R:1 (attend une seconde entre les tentatives et réessaie seulement une fois, histoire d'éviter que le soft ne boucle 1'000'000 de fois sur le même fichier au cas où il ne serait vraiment pas possible de le lire)
Marsh Posté le 15-02-2009 à 22:58:23
Salut, il sort d'où ton robocopy ? De mémoire celui du resource kit de windows 2003 avait déjà cette option.
En tout cas celui fourni sous Vista le /ZB est supporté, mais malheureusement il ne fonctionne pas si ma mémoire est bonne sous 2K3.
Regarde avec "robocopy /?" tu as peut-être les paramètres /Z et /B séparés.
Marsh Posté le 16-02-2009 à 12:53:09
Ok merci c'était une mauvaise version. Cela fonctionne bien (/ZB) sous Win2k3.
@+
Marsh Posté le 15-02-2009 à 10:31:15
Bonjour à tous,
Suite à un plantage de donnée je me suis lancé dans l'installation d'un batch avec robocopy.
La sauvegarde se lance très bien, mais arrivé à un moment, le script plante par "error 5" access denied. Cela arrive sur des fichiers Thumbs.db donc je les ai exclu de la sauvegarde.
Ensuite cela arrive sur d'autre fichier *.pdf, *.xls et toujours "access denied". Je suis Win2003 server et connecté en Admnistrateur. Avez vous des idées ?
@+